曙海教育集團
全國報名免費熱線:4008699035 微信:shuhaipeixun
或15921673576(微信同號) QQ:1299983702
首頁 課程表 在線聊 報名 講師 品牌 QQ聊 活動 就業
 
Dubbo核心解鎖微服務課程培訓

 
  班級規模及環境--熱線:4008699035 手機:15921673576( 微信同號)
      每個班級的人數限3到5人,互動授課, 保障效果,小班授課。
  上間和地點
上部份地點:【上海】同濟大學(滬西)/新城金郡商務樓(11號線白銀路站)【深圳分部】:電影大廈(地鐵一號線大劇院站)/深圳大學成教院【北京分部】:北京中山學院/福鑫大樓【南京分部】:金港大廈(和燕路)【武漢分部】:佳源大廈(高新二路)【成都分部】:領館區1號(中和大道)【沈陽分部】:沈陽理工大學/六宅臻品【鄭州分部】:鄭州大學/錦華大廈【石家莊分部】:河北科技大學/瑞景大廈
最近開間(周末班/連續班/晚班):2019年1月26日
  實驗設備
    ◆小班教學,教學效果好
       
       ☆注重質量☆邊講邊練

       ☆合格學員免費推薦工作
       ★實驗設備請點擊這兒查看★
  質量保障

       1、培訓過程中,如有部分內容理解不透或消化不好,可免費在以后培訓班中重聽;
       2、培訓結束后,授課老師留給學員聯系方式,保障培訓效果,免費提供課后技術支持。
       3、培訓合格學員可享受免費推薦就業機會。☆合格學員免費頒發相關工程師等資格證書,提升職業資質。專注高端技術培訓15年,端海學員的能力得到大家的認同,受到用人單位的廣泛贊譽,端海的證書受到廣泛認可。

部份程大綱
 
  • 第1章 微服務入門
    本章中將概要介紹微服務與傳統應用之間的差異與實現優勢,以便于幫助同學們更加清晰微服務在項目開發中的定位。
  • 1-1 課程導學 試看
    1-2 學前必讀(助你平穩踩坑,暢學無憂)
    1-3 傳統應用帶來的問題
    1-4 微服務概述
    第2章 演示環境構建
    本章中將通過一系列的基本演示,讓同學們可以對Dubbo有一個快速直觀的認識。當前項目中構建了目前Dubbo的兩種主流兼容框架Spring和Springboot,并且都進行了Dubbo集成,以便于適應多種需求下的應對使用。
  • 2-1 基礎環境構建介紹
    2-2 Spring基礎環境構建
    2-3 Spring的直連提供者
    2-4 SpringBoot基礎環境構建
    2-5 SpringBoot直連提供者演示
    2-6 注冊中心概述
    2-7 Zookeeper-windows安裝
    2-8 Spring集成注冊中心
    2-9 Springboot集成注冊中心
    第3章 業務基礎環境構建
    經過上一章節的演示,讓大家了解到Dubbo與Spring、Springboot集成和基本使用,本章中會將Dubbo與Guns進行集成,構建一個業務系統的基本環境,同時針對API網關進行了一個簡單的描述和引入,為后續章節打下鋪墊。
  • 3-1 API網關介紹
    3-2 Guns環境構建
    3-3 API網關模塊構建測試
    3-4 API網關集成Dubbo
    3-5 抽離業務API
    3-6 理解Dubbo的調用流程與Dubbo多協議解析
    第4章 Dubbo基本特性:用戶模塊開發
    本章中將基于Springboot和Dubbo的結合,進行用戶模塊業務開發,并且會學習注冊發現、負載均衡、路由策略等多項Dubbo核心特性。除此以外,會進一步了解API網關與業務模塊的結合和開發。
  • 4-1 用戶模塊概要介紹
    4-2 接口文檔和sql語句見面會
    4-3 用戶服務與網關交互
    4-4 基于Springboot配置忽略列表
    4-5 基于用戶業務的API修改
    4-6 修改JWT申請的返回報文
    4-7 Threadlocal保存用戶信息
    4-8 JWT修改測試和總結
    4-9 用戶模塊-DAO層代碼生成
    4-10 用戶模塊-注冊業務實現
    4-11 用戶模塊-登陸和用戶名驗證實現
    4-12 用戶模塊-查詢用戶信息
    4-13 用戶模塊-修改用戶信息實現
    4-14 網關模塊-注冊功能實現
    4-15 網關模塊-用戶名檢查和退出功能實現
    4-16 網關模塊-用戶信息相關功能實現
    4-17 用戶名驗證接口測試
    4-18 用戶注冊接口測試
    4-19 用戶信息查詢接口測試
    4-20 用戶信息修改接口測試
    4-21 Dubbo特性-啟動檢查
    4-22 Dubbo特性-負載均衡 試看
    4-23 Dubbo特性-多協議支持
    4-24 章節總結歸納
    第5章 Dubbo服務開發:影片模塊開發
    本章中將結合影片模塊的開發,幫助同學們進一步了解Gateway的功能聚合的開發、異步調用等Dubbo特性;同時,會引入Lombok框架,并將詳細講解Dubbo的通信、線程模型等特性,以及相應的業務實現。
  • 5-1 影片模塊介紹
    5-2 影片模塊創建
    5-3 初識API網關特性 - 功能聚合
    5-4 Lombok框架引入和使用介紹
    5-5 首頁實現 - VO對象創建
    5-6 首頁實現 - Api接口定義
    5-7 電影模塊-數據層生成
    5-8 首頁實現 - Banner數據層
    5-9 首頁實現 - 影片查詢
    5-10 首頁實現 - 其他查詢
    5-11 首頁實現 - 數據層補充及API整合
    5-12 首頁實現 - 測試及ResponseVO調整
    5-13 條件列表實現 - 表現層及交互實體實現
    5-14 條件列表實現 - 結構建立
    5-15 條件列表實現 - 數據層實現 (1)
    5-16 條件列表實現 - 數據層實現(2)
    5-17 條件列表實現 - 表現層業務講解
    5-18 條件列表實現 - 表現層業務實現(1)
    5-19 條件列表實現 - 表現層業務實現(2)
    5-20 條件列表實現 - 表現層業務實現(3)
    5-21 影片查詢功能實現 - 思路介紹
    5-22 影片查詢功能實現 - Service層實現
    5-23 影片查詢功能實現 - 數據層實現(1)
    5-24 影片查詢功能實現 - 數據層實現(2)
    5-25 影片查詢功能實現 - 數據層實現(3)
    5-26 影片查詢功能實現 - 網關實現
    5-27 影片查詢功能實現 - 單元測試
    5-28 影片詳情查詢 - 業務介紹
    5-29 影片詳情查詢第一部分 - API定義
    5-30 影片詳情查詢第一部分 - 自定義SQL實現(1)
    5-31 影片詳情查詢第一部分 - 自定義SQL實現(2)
    5-32 影片詳情查詢第一部分 - 自定義SQL實現(3)
    5-33 影片詳情查詢第一部分 - 網關實現
    5-34 影片詳情查詢第二部分 - API定義
    5-35 影片詳情查詢第二部分 -數據層實現(1)
    5-36 影片詳情查詢第二部分 - 數據層實現(2)
    5-37 影片詳情查詢 - 網關實現
    5-38 業務結果測試
    5-39 Dubbo特性之異步調用講解
    5-40 Spring版Dubbo異步調用演示
    5-41 業務系統集成Dubbo異步調用(1)
    5-42 業務系統集成Dubbo異步調用實現(2)
    5-43 影片模塊總結
    第6章 Dubbo服務開發:影院模塊開發
    本章中將完成影院模塊開發,保證整個業務的連貫性,同時將詳細講解包括并發控制、連接控制、事件通知和結果緩存等Dubbo特性,并結合相應的業務進行實現。
  • 6-1 章節導讀和表結構介紹
    6-2 影院模塊構建
    6-3 影院模塊服務網關結構構建
    6-4 接口文檔與界面之間的對應關系
    6-5 分析服務網關的數據需求
    6-6 API實體對象創建
    6-7 分析API所需接口
    6-8 設計API接口
    6-9 Cinema模塊數據層生成以及邏輯層構建
    6-10 Cinema模塊實現 - 影院列表查詢實現
    6-11 Cinema模塊實現 - 查詢條件列表實現
    6-12 Cinema模塊實現 - 根據編號查詢影院信息實現
    6-13 Cinema模塊實現 - 查詢某影院下所有電影和場次
    6-14 Cinema模塊實現 - 查詢特定場次相關信息
    6-15 Cinema模塊實現 - 查詢特定場次的影片信息
    6-16 Cinema網關實現 - 獲取影院列表
    6-17 cinema網關實現 - 獲取影院查詢條件
    6-18 Cinema網關實現 - 獲取所有上映場次信息
    6-19 Cinema網關實現 - 獲取特定場次信息
    6-20 Cinema模塊測試以及全局異常處理
    6-21 Dubbo特性之結果緩存
    6-22 Dubbo特性之并發與連接控制
    6-23 Spring環境演示
    6-24 Springboot環境演示
    第7章 Dubbo服務開發:訂單模塊開發
    本章中將會講解訂單模塊,作為本系統中的重中之重,這個模塊的講解中也會涉及到幾個在微服務領域中比較重要的點,包括分布式事務、服務熔斷降級、分表分庫以后的應對思路和限流的實現等等相關內容。在業務實現講解的同時,本章會涉及到的Dubbo知識點主要包括:服務分組、版本控制、訪問日志等。...
  • 7-1 訂單模塊介紹
    7-2 window ftp服務器構建
    7-3 訂單模塊環境構建
    7-4 訂單模塊服務網關構建
    7-5 訂單模塊接口分析
    7-6 訂單模塊API定義
    7-7 訂單模塊 - 數據層生成
    7-8 訂單模塊 - 獲取座位地址實現
    7-9 訂單模塊 - FTP工具實現
    7-10 Springboot配置以及Springboot測試講解
    7-11 訂單模塊 - 判斷ID傳入是否正確實現
    7-12 訂單模塊 - 判斷是否已售座位
    7-13 訂單模塊 - 創建新訂單
    7-14 訂單信息查詢SQL開發
    7-15 訂單信息查詢 - 業務層實現
    7-16 訂單模塊 - 獲取所有已售座位業務實現
    7-17 訂單模塊 - 影院模塊獲取已售座位業務實現及調試
    7-18 訂單模塊 - 購票API網關實現
    7-19 訂單模塊 - 獲取當前用戶訂單信息
    7-20 訂單模塊 - 購票業務測試以及相關內容修改
    7-21 訂單模塊 - 獲取訂單信息接口測試
    7-22 訂單業務之后的問題總結
    7-23 分庫分表業務介紹
    7-24 Dubbo特性之分組
    7-25 Dubbo特性之分組聚合
    7-26 Dubbo特性之版本控制
    7-27 業務改造 - 分組合并
    7-28 分組合并結果測試
    7-29 限流算法介紹
    7-30 限流算法集成業務系統
    7-31 熔斷器Hystrix流程介紹
    7-32 熔斷器效果演示
    7-33 解決熔斷器下用戶無法獲取問題
    7-34 訂單模塊總結
    第8章 Dubbo服務開發:支付模塊開發
    本章將帶領大家實現對接支付寶的SDK,并且使用其沙箱環境完成整套支付動作。同時我們會引入一些與支付業務相關的幾個Dubbo特性,比如隱式參數、參數驗證和本地偽裝,為支付業務保駕護航
  • 8-1 支付業務介紹
    8-2 當面付實例工程構建
    8-3 當面付功能演示
    8-4 支付模塊構建
    8-5 支付模塊網關與API設計
    8-6 訂單模塊適配改造
    8-7 支付模塊實現 - 獲取二維碼地址
    8-8 支付模塊實現 - 查詢訂單支付狀態
    8-9 支付模塊 - 服務網關實現
    8-10 支付模塊 - 全流程測試
    8-11 二維碼上傳FTP實現
    8-12 Dubbo特性之本地存根介紹
    8-13 本地存根演示和使用場景介紹
    8-14 Dubbo特性之本地偽裝介紹
    8-15 本地偽裝演示
    8-16 本地偽裝結合業務實現以及注意事項
    8-17 隱式參數傳遞講解與實現
    8-18 課程總結
    第9章 分布式事務
    微服務的冪等性是微服務的核心之一,本章中將主要講解分布式事務的產生原因、解決方案;同時會引入柔性補償性事務和傳統事務的解決方案。最后,我們會引入兩種業務場景,分別講解補償式事務與兩段式事務提交之間的優劣勢和選擇的前提。...
  • 9-1 章節介紹
    9-2 事務簡介
    9-3 分布式事務介紹
    9-4 分布式事務實現思路介紹
    9-5 兩段式和三段式事務介紹
    9-6 基于XA的分布式事務介紹
    9-7 基于消息的最終一致性方案介紹
    9-8 TCC柔性補償式事務
    9-9 兩種分布式事務優劣勢比較
    9-10 主流分布式事務框架介紹
    9-11 TCC-Transaction環境構建
    9-12 HTTP案例部署展示
    9-13 Dubbo案例部署展示
    9-14 子事務紅包模塊解讀
    9-15 主事務訂單模塊解讀
    9-16 StringBoot環境準備
    9-17 基礎環境配置詳解
    9-18 流程演示以及jar包調整
    9-19 訂單業務模擬分布式事務
    9-20 訂單業務結果展示
    9-21 TCC框架現象帶來的一些思考
    9-22 TCC框架事務存儲器解析
    9-23 Compensable攔截器講解(上) 試看
    9-24 Compensable攔截器講解(下)
    9-25 Resource攔截器講解
    9-26 事務job講解
    9-27 分布式事務章節總結
    第10章 服務監控
    Dubbo的服務鏈路監控是服務架構里比較重要的地方之一,同時也是面試里經常會被問到的點,在這里將會引入zipkin+brave的形式解決全鏈路監控的問題
  • 10-1 章節導讀
    10-2 Dubbo Monitor介紹
    10-3 Dubbo-Monitor演示
    10-4 Dubbo-admin介紹
    10-5 Dubbo-admin安裝部署
    10-6 Dubbo-admin演示01
    10-7 Dubbo-admin演示02
    10-8 Dubbo-admin演示03
    10-9 Dubbo-admin演示04
    10-10 鏈路監控介紹
    10-11 Dubbo特性之Filter介紹
    10-12 Spring環境演示Filter
    10-13 Springboot環境演示Filter
    10-14 Zipkin Spring環境演示
    10-15 業務系統集成Zipkin 01
    10-16 業務系統集成Zipkin02
    10-17 運行環境介紹
    10-18 本地虛擬機安裝
    10-19 阿里云申請ECS服務器
    10-20 阿里云域名注冊
    10-21 虛擬機初始化以及MySQL安裝01
    10-22 MySQL安裝02
    10-23 遠程命令行工具安裝與使用
    10-24 VSFtp安裝部署
    10-25 JDK和Zookeeper安裝
    10-26 數據初始化與工程打包
    10-27 微服務獨立運行
    10-28 Openresty安裝部署
    10-29 Openresty反向代理配置
    10-30 NodeJS安裝
    10-31 整體效果演示
    第11章 微服務面試總結
    講師本人使用微服務已經很多年,在本章會總結和梳理市面上經常會遇到的Dubbo相關的微服務問題,尤其是架構設計層面上的問題,為大家的順利求職保駕護航。
  • 11-1 章節介紹
    11-2 Dubbo結構圖和常識講解
    11-3 服務治理講解
    11-4 服務網關講解
    11-5 分布式事務
    11-6 服務冪等性
    11-7 限流方案介紹
    11-8 自動化運維部署介紹
 

-

 

  備案號:備案號:滬ICP備08026168號-1 .(2024年07月24日)...............
主站蜘蛛池模板: 天天爽天天狠久久久综合麻豆| 欧美精品综合视频一区二区| 夜鲁鲁鲁夜夜综合视频欧美| 色综合久久88色综合天天 | 狠狠色婷婷久久综合频道日韩| 亚洲综合色在线观看亚洲| 91精品国产综合久久四虎久久无码一级| 亚洲va欧美va国产综合| 色综合欧美在线视频区| 色诱久久久久综合网ywww| 亚洲性感综合欧美| 综合久久国产九一剧情麻豆| 久久综合狠狠综合久久激情 | 激情综合婷婷丁香五月蜜桃| 国产成人精品综合久久久| 国产欧美日韩综合一区在线播放| 亚洲国产综合专区在线电影| 亚州欧州一本综合天堂网| 亚洲国产日韩成人综合天堂| 亚洲av一综合av一区| 欧洲 亚洲 国产图片综合| 久久婷婷成人综合色综合| 亚洲 欧洲 日韩 综合在线| 九九久久99综合一区二区| 国产欧美日韩综合精品二区| 99久久国产综合精品网成人影院| 国产精品九九久久精品女同亚洲欧美日韩综合区| 亚洲国产精品成人AV无码久久综合影院| 亚洲 欧美 日韩 综合aⅴ视频| 久久婷婷色综合一区二区| 国产成人AV综合久久| 亚洲综合精品香蕉久久网97| 狠狠色丁香婷婷综合| 91精品国产综合久久香蕉| 亚洲欧美日韩国产综合在线| 国产成人亚洲综合无码精品| 久久青青草原综合伊人| 亚洲乱码中文字幕综合234| 久久综合精品国产二区无码| 久久婷婷国产综合精品| 九九久久99综合一区二区|